About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Serve as a subject matter expert (SME) for customer contracting and payment processes
- Lead or support process improvement initiatives to enhance efficiency, accuracy, compliance, and scalability within contracting and payment workflows
- Develop and implement standard operating procedures, job aids, and best practices to ensure consistent execution across the organization
- Partner with Compliance, Legal, Finance, and Marketing to ensure activities align with regulatory requirements, Sunshine Act reporting, and internal policies
- Conduct quality reviews and trend analysis to identify risks, recurring issues, and opportunities for operational improvement
- Support system enhancements, testing, and implementation activities related to contract and payment management platforms
- Provide training, onboarding, and ongoing support to team members and business partners on contracting and payment processes
- Develop and maintain reporting dashboards or metrics to monitor workload, turnaround times, compliance adherence, and operational performance
- Facilitate cross-functional alignment on contracting and payment processes, helping to standardize practices across business units
- Lead or support large-scale projects or initiatives, including process transitions, system implementations, or operational transformations
- Proactively identify operational risks and compliance considerations and recommend mitigation strategies
- Act as a key liaison between shared services and business stakeholders, ensuring clear communication and effective issue resolution
- Receive and process requests to create contract records as well as payments
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or’s degree required
- Minimum 7 years of relevant experience, or advanced degree with a minimum of 5 years of relevant experience
- Experience working with non-sales contracts or in a contract-related capacity
- Experience with contract management, payment processing, or shared services operations in a large, matrixed organization
- Demonstrated experience leading cross‑functional projects or process improvement initiatives
- Experience working with healthcare compliance requirements, including the U.S. Sunshine Act, global transparency reporting, or HCP engagement policies
- Familiarity with enterprise workflow or project management tools
- Experience supporting or participating in system implementations, enhancements, or user acceptance testing (UAT)
- Advanced data analysis and reporting skills
- Knowledge of financial processes, including invoicing, accruals, and vendor payment workflows within systems such as SAP
- Experience developing standard operating procedures (SOPs), job aids, or training materials
- Familiarity or background in audit support, compliance monitoring, or internal controls within a regulated industry
- Ability to mentor or provide functional guidance to team members or business partners
- Experience working with U.S. and international healthcare professional (HCP) contracting requirements
